Output 446ec6426667b39a1de273647b1553c4d5dec12d31a72a86afdd6412fa8d4aa5:1

value
25013469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c2057b8ebe688e402e5861b3b2f9cbfceccc590 OP_EQUAL
address
3BYjeUAjvB6nt54NqgfWKth5RMLZCBAb1T
transaction
446ec6426667b39a1de273647b1553c4d5dec12d31a72a86afdd6412fa8d4aa5
spent
true